- Australian Army Tips for Crushing Kapooka in 2020 & Goodbye to 31 Platoon who start their military careers tomorrow making 2020 the most memorable year of their lives and leaving creature comforts behind to enlist in the best small army in the world.
Kapooka is long nearly 100 days without a break but you are not alone and within this video are tips and tricks to just get through recruit/ basic training but to thrive and enjoy the new mates that will all be soldiers and on the same journey if not the same end point.
As we come out of Winter 31 Platoon will be the next batch of young men and women to step forward so lets wish these volunteers well and if they are going to make a mistake then only let it happen once.
You start basic training to become a Australian all CORP's soldier before going to your specialisation Initial Employment Training Muster and you reputation starts with 100 points so be a great team mate and do anything you can to assist in morale for your mates and we shall see you on the other side now go and enjoy your last meal and fun beneath the covers plus don't forget your pets they won't understand where you have gone.
